How Our Attic Water Removal Process Works

When water enters your attic, every minute counts. Our team understands the urgency and will work tirelessly to reduce damage and disruption. From initial assessment to final restoration, we’ll guide you through every step of the process.

Step 1: Assessment and Preparation

Our technicians will inspect your attic to identify the source of the water and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ll prepare the area, protecting your belongings and securing the space.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use high-capacity pumps to remove standing water from your attic. Our equipment is designed to extract water quickly, reducing the risk of further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Using specialized equipment, we’ll dry the attic space, ensuring all surfaces are dry and free from moisture.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 4: Cleanup and Sanitizing

Our technicians will thoroughly clean and disinfect the area, removing any remaining debris and contaminants. This step is essential in preventing future mold growth and ensuring a healthy living environment.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Once the area is dry and clean, we’ll repair and restore your attic to its original condition. This may include replacing damaged insulation, repairing or replacing ceiling tiles, and addressing any other damage.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Removal

Ignoring attic water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Be aware of these warning signs and take action before it’s too late: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your attic can show mold growth or water accumulation.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to serious health issues and property damage.

Warped or Sagging Ceilings

Water damage can cause ceilings to become warped or sag. Don’t wait until the damage is irreversible, address the issue quickly to prevent further problems.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Water stains or leaks in your attic can show a more serious issue. Our team will identify and address the problem before it’s too late.

Increased Pest Activity

Water damage can attract pests like rodents, cockroaches, and silverfish. Don’t let these unwanted critters take over your attic, trust our team to remove them and prevent future infestations.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your attic can show structural damage or water accumulation. Don’t ignore these signs, our team will investigate and address the issue quickly.

Attic Water Removal Cost In West University Place, TX

The cost of Attic Water Removal in West University Place, TX will depend on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, with the final price determined by a thorough on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and technician’s labor costs.
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and technician’s labor costs.
Cleanup and sanitizing $100 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type and amount of cleaning agents required, and technician’s labor costs.
Restoration and repair $500 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type and extent of damage, and technician’s labor costs.
Equipment rental and maintenance $100 – $500 Duration of rental, type of equipment, and technician’s labor costs.
